    Lightbulb Ok, let's staff a new rock opera!

    On the ES335 Thread, I was in my off topic way suggesting that the Hagstrom Viking looked like something out of a rock opera version of the Lord of the Rings Trilogy. (I listened to Tommy in its entirety last night when the local station played it, and I guess it put me in the mood!). I know there are a few LOTR fans out there (Tone?) Here is my open mic task for any who want to play.

    Staff the main characters of the series, and set them up with a guitar, bass or other instrument for the Rock Opera version. Make the guitar brand/model fit.

    For instance:

    Aragorn - 1960 Relic Stratocaster LTD (with Brazilian Rosewood Fingerboard)
    Gandalf - PRS 513 Platinum metallic (5 single coils, 13 sounds)
    Sauraman - S2170SE shred metal guitar - Black and grey NTF color with wizard neck
    Sauron - Gibson SG, black and red
    Elrond - Hagstrom Viking (just looks like it came from Rivendell)

    (Repeated solo contests of varying styles among the above)

    Frodo - mandolin
    Sam - Fend P-Bass
    Pippin - Telecaster
    Meriadoc - Gibson LP
    Gimli - Tama full drum kit with Zildjan high hats
    Legolas - Martin D-18

    Gollum - beat up banjo

    Ok, how would you guys outfit the film? Who have I left out?
